Decay of Polarization Singularities of an Erf-Gaussian Beam Due to External Perturbations
This article is devoted to a new direction of modern singular optics—Erf-Gaussian (EG) beams that carry a fractional topological charge. It is shown that Erf-Gaussian beams were generated using an axicon and an anisotropic crystal, and the polarization characteristics of these beams with a fractional topological charge in the vicinity of the beam axis were experimentally studied. Theoretical calculations were confirmed and it was shown that Erf-Gaussian beams introduce changes into the original picture of the polarization distribution, and that the central spiral polarization umbilical splits into two polarization features of the “lemon” type. The method described in the article for generating and analyzing polarization singularity in Erf-Gaussian beams based on a fractional topological charge can be used in optical profilometry to analyze the polarization and phase properties of materials and surface roughness.

The journal covers a wide range of issues in information optics such as optical memory, mechanisms for optical data recording and processing, photosensitive materials, optical, optoelectronic and holographic nanostructures, and many other related topics. Papers on memory systems using holographic and biological structures and concepts of brain operation are also included. The journal pays particular attention to research in the field of neural net systems that may lead to a new generation of computional technologies by endowing them with intelligence.
